Abstract

653,717. Moulds; casting processes. WAHLSTROM, S. L. Oct. 7, 1948, No. 26207. [A Specification was laid open to inspection under Sect. 91 of the Acts, April 9, 1949.] [Class 83 (i)] An ingot mould 1 is provided with a feeder head 2 of sheet-metal surrounded with carbonaceous combustible material 3. This may consist of wood and either rest on the top of the mould or be, inserted therein. The head 2 extends partly or wholly within the mould and' either engages it or is spaced somewhat away from it, as shown in Fig. 3. In this case the head 2 may have a thickness up to 4 mm. at least at its lower edge to accelerate solidification of the molten metal between the head and mould. To delay combustion the material 3 may be enclosed in a cover 5, Fig. 7, which may be open at the bottom or at the top or at both top and bottom as shown in Fig. 11. As shown in this Figure, the cover may also be inclined so that it falls as the material 3 shrinks.
